Source: National Adult Day Services Association (NADSA) Adult day care center site visit checklist: • Did you feel welcome? • Were the center services and activities properly explained? • Were you given information regarding staffing, programming, and costs? • Is the facility clean, pleasant, and free of odor? • Is the building and site wheelchair accessible? • Is the furniture sturdy and comfortable? Costs and financial assistance for adult day care In the U.S., the average cost for an adult day care center is about $64 per day, depending on where you live and the services provided (e.g., meals, transportation, nursing supervision). Professional health care services will mean higher fees. Many facilities offer services on a sliding fee scale, meaning that what you pay is based on your income and ability to pay.
